“NCIS: LOS ANGELES” TOPS “THE WALKING DEAD” IN VIEWERS
Sunday’s Broadcast Is the First Scripted Drama to Out-Deliver “The Walking Dead” since March 2014 “NCIS: Los Angeles” Is Television’s Most Watched Drama Last Week Sunday’s broadcast of NCIS: LOS ANGELES (12.11m) out-delivered “The Walking Dead” (11.51m) in viewers, according to Nielsen live plus same day ratings for Nov. 13. NCIS: LOS ANGELES becomes the first scripted Sunday drama to top “The Walking Dead” in live plus same day viewer delivery since March 9, 2014. “THE TALK” AND “LET’S MAKE A DEAL” DELIVER THEIR LARGEST WEEKLY AUDIENCES SINCE MAY
THE TALK and LET’S MAKE DEAL both delivered their largest average weekly audiences since May, according to Nielsen live plus same day ratings for the week ending Nov. 11. THE TALK averaged 2.88 million viewers, up +7% from a week ago and +10% from the same week last year. It was THE TALK’s largest weekly audience since the week ending May 13. “THE PRICE IS RIGHT” DELIVERS ITS LARGEST WEEKLY AUDIENCE SINCE MAY
THE PRICE IS RIGHT delivered its largest weekly audience since May, according to Nielsen live plus same day ratings for the week ending Oct. 28. THE PRICE IS RIGHT averaged 4.84m, up +6% from last week and its largest average weekly audience since the week ending May 20.
